About agriculture in Shijiang
Located in Jiangxi Province, Shijiang is surrounded by the characteristic rolling hills and verdant valleys of southeastern China. The landscape is defined by its humid subtropical climate, featuring numerous small rivers and a patchwork of fertile fields that stretch toward the horizon. The rural architecture often reflects traditional styles, integrated into the natural topography of the river basins.
The agricultural sector in Shijiang is dominated by rice cultivation, taking advantage of the region's abundant rainfall and established irrigation systems. Beyond staple grains, the area is known for growing rapeseed and various seasonal vegetables that supply local markets. Fruit production, particularly citrus varieties like oranges and tangerines, is common on the well-drained slopes of the nearby hills.
For agronomists and seasonal workers, Shijiang offers opportunities primarily tied to the planting and harvesting cycles of rice and citrus. Labor demand peaks during the late spring and autumn harvest seasons, requiring significant manpower for manual and mechanized tasks. Professionals coming to the area can expect a traditional rural environment focused on optimizing crop yields and managing local water resources effectively.
